War and ecology. The environment and climate in defence policy (France and the United States)

This book explores how environmental and climate issues are taken into account in the defence sector in France and the United States. Adrien Estève, Paris, PUF, 2022
The army in society

This opus presents the evolution of France's defence system since the end of the Cold War. It looks in particular at the army-nation link, military presence in the territories, changes in the defence budget and the characteristics of the French defence industry. Cahiers français , No. 428, July-August 2022
Never Brothers? Ukraine and Russia: a post-Soviet tragedy

Drawing on her field experience in Russia and Ukraine, Anna Colin Lebedev traces the trajectories of Russian and Ukrainian society in the post-Soviet years. The book offers a useful historical perspective for understanding Russian-Ukrainian relations. Publisher: SEUIL Book editor: Anna Colin Lebedev Language: French Publication date: 02 September [...]

What kind of peace for Ukraine?
Understanding the causes of war in order to put an end to it
Drawing on a study of the origins of the conflict and the theories of the end of the war, the text explains that lasting peace in Ukraine can only be achieved by setting up a credible Ukrainian deterrent force and overhauling Moscow's neo-imperialism. France, a powerhouse of initiatives in the Indo-Pacific
This article presents France's strategy in the Indo-Pacific region. It shows that in addition to defending its sovereign interests in the region, France is seeking to assert itself as a power of initiative capable of providing solutions to security, economic, health, climate and environmental challenges. What is a just war?

On Friday 11 November, Lt-Gen Benoît Durieux, Director of the IHEDN, and Mgr de Romanet, Bishop of the French Armed Forces, discussed a concept that is still relevant today, formalised as far back as Antiquity and brought to light once again by the tragedy of the war in Ukraine. Beyond what religions preach, and which states should put into practice, is there a way to avoid resorting to this form of exacerbated violence? In an age of new forms of conflict, from information warfare to cyber and hybrid warfare, what can be said about the relevance of this concept?
